Title : The Good Samaritan

Author : Susan Howe

Genre : Short Story, Literary Fiction, Women's Fiction, General Fiction

Review Extract from Review By: jcoffey

"The Good Samaritan

Susan - this a lovely piece of writing. It comes across as authentic and totally plausible. I was engaged straight away, even though I began it thinking I wouldn't be. It left me wondering how the story might progress (wondering in a good way) and even if it isn't (yet?), it could quite easily become part of a longer story. However, it stands very well on its own. I was left really wanting to know what Rachel was going to say....

I haven't really got any negative points to make (unusual for me).

Thanks for a very enjoyable read and best of luck"


Synopsis
Mary's record spoke for itself. Kind and patient, always ready with tea and sympathy, there wasn't a more dedicated volunteer. Until she realised that charity begins at home.
